The problem with all the discussion of what everyone is paying is that rarely have the comments taken the whole picture into account.

Geography is a huge factor. Even in the Portland Metro area, living in one county vs another has a dramatic effect on rates.

Coverages are something else. I carry 100/300 and have a million dollar personal liability umbrella. Lots of people carry the state minimum which will significantly reduce the rate.

So while $2000 / year sounds pretty high, we don't know what kind of coverage or what effect his zip code has on that rate.
